Job Overview:

Rendr360 is a department of Rendr which provides centralized support to our medical practices: care management, care coordination, continuous quality improvement, etc. We are a growing division with many patient-centered projects which provide continuity of care for patients between office visits to help improve clinical outcomes and patient satisfaction. One of these programs is the Transitional Care Management (TCM) Program.

Our TCM Coordinator helps by assisting patients through the transition from extended care facilities (hospital, rehabilitation, nursing facility, etc) to an outpatient setting. They help connect patients to our Rendr360 nurses, schedule appointments, and ensure closure of quality measures.

Essential Functions:

  • Coordinates with internal and external stakeholders in an effort to provide concierge-level service to patients entering our system for the first time, or navigating our system on their journey to wellness.
  • Assists clinicians on various tasks including patient scheduling, patient care notifications, follow-up care, and other tasks involved with aiding in care gap closure.
  • Manages daily admission discharge transfer (ADT) data from our Health Information Exchange (HIE) partners.  
  • Assists a wide variety of stakeholders with various quality, care coordination, and population health projects.
